Mazzega Spiral Table Lamp

Hard to find spiral table lamp by was designed in the 60s by Carlo Nason for Mazzega Italy. Glass artist Carlo Nason is well known for his use of historical techniques in producing inventive lamps, vases, and sculptures. As a kid he was involved very quickly in the process of glassblowing, as his family is one of the island of Murano’s oldest glass blowing families. Today, his works are in the collections of the Corning Museum of Glass and The Museum of Modern Art in New York. This unique lamp has a brushed steel case that holds two textured circles in Murano glass. The spiral pattern on the glass sketches a nice shadow - drawing when the lamp lights up. Very decorative and in all good condition.

Width :     31 cm / 12.2 inch

Depth :     10 cm / 3.94 inch

Height :     32 cm / 12.6 inch
